Non-Latching Mode:
The unit will operate in the non-latching mode if no circuit is completed across pins 9 & 11. After input voltage is applied (LED is Green) and the start-up sensing delay (ts) of 0.1 – 10 seconds is completed, the relay will energize when the monitored current is above the adjustable pick-up setting (“Threshold”). The LED will be Red. It will de-energize when the monitored current goes below the adjustable drop-out setting (“Hysteresis”) by 5-50% of the selected pick-up setting or when input voltage is removed. The LED will be Green.
Latching Mode:
The unit will operate in the latching mode if a N.C. contact (Memory S2) is connected across pins 9 & 11 (see Wiring Diagram). After input voltage is applied (LED is Green) and the start-up sensing delay (ts) of 0.1 – 10 seconds is completed, the relay will energize when the monitored current is above the adjustable pick-up setting (“Threshold”). The LED will be Red. It will de-energize when the monitored current goes below the adjustable drop-out setting (“Hysteresis”) by 5-50% of the selected pick-up setting and the N.C. contact (Memory S2) is opened, or when input voltage is removed. The LED will be Green. It is recommended to set the Hysteresis at 5% when in the latching mode.
